Craftsmanship in the modern economy holds a unique and irreplaceable position, especially when observed through the lens of the meat processing industry. This sector, with its intricate balance of tradition and innovation, exemplifies how artisanal skills not only survive but thrive amidst the technological advancements of the 21st century. The role of craftsmanship in this field is not just about preserving age-old techniques; it's about integrating these methods with modern practices to meet contemporary demands. This article delves into the significance of craftsmanship in the meat processing industry, exploring how it contributes to sustainability, quality, and cultural heritage.

<h2 style="font-weight: bold; margin: 12px 0;">The Essence of Craftsmanship in Meat Processing</h2>

Craftsmanship in meat processing is a testament to the meticulous attention to detail and the profound knowledge of the artisans. These craftsmen are not mere workers; they are custodians of a rich heritage, possessing skills honed over generations. Their expertise encompasses a deep understanding of the types of meat, the intricacies of cutting, curing, and aging processes, and the art of flavor enhancement through natural preservatives. This section of the industry underscores the importance of human touch in maintaining quality and authenticity, elements often lost in mass production.

<h2 style="font-weight: bold; margin: 12px 0;">Sustainability and Ethical Practices</h2>

One of the most compelling arguments for the continued relevance of craftsmanship in the meat processing industry is its contribution to sustainability and ethical practices. Artisanal methods are inherently more sustainable, focusing on quality over quantity, which leads to less waste and a smaller environmental footprint. Moreover, craftsmen often source their materials locally, supporting local agriculture and reducing the carbon emissions associated with transportation. Ethical considerations are also at the forefront of artisanal meat processing, with a strong emphasis on animal welfare and fair labor practices.

<h2 style="font-weight: bold; margin: 12px 0;">Bridging Tradition and Innovation</h2>

The meat processing industry is at a crossroads, where tradition meets innovation. Craftsmanship plays a pivotal role in this junction, acting as a bridge that connects the past with the future. Artisans are increasingly incorporating modern technologies into their traditional practices, enhancing efficiency without compromising the quality or integrity of the product. This fusion of old and new ensures that the industry can adapt to changing consumer preferences, such as the demand for organic and free-range products, while still preserving the essence of artisanal production.

<h2 style="font-weight: bold; margin: 12px 0;">Cultural Heritage and Consumer Connection</h2>

Craftsmanship in meat processing is not just about the product; it's about the story behind it. Artisanal products carry with them a sense of place and history, connecting consumers to the cultural heritage of the region. This connection fosters a deeper appreciation and understanding of the food we consume, encouraging a more mindful approach to eating. In an era where consumers are increasingly detached from the source of their food, craftsmanship offers a tangible link to tradition and authenticity.
